Technology's Role: Facilitating and Tracking Spam Calls

Technology has significantly transformed how we communicate, but it has also inadvertently facilitated a parallel rise in spam calls. Advanced technologies enable spammers to track, target, and automate their campaigns, making them more sophisticated and harder to trace. For instance, automated dialers can make thousands of calls per minute, leveraging data mining techniques to identify numbers with higher call completion rates, often targeting specific demographics or those with unlisted or newly assigned phone numbers.
Spam call lawyers Nevada have seen an increase in cases involving these advanced technologies. Automated systems can quickly adapt to blocking or forwarding attempts, making traditional spam filtering less effective. Moreover, voice over IP (VoIP) technology allows spammers to mask their identities and locations, further complicating efforts to trace and regulate them. This has led to a cat-and-mouse game between service providers and spammers, with the latter continually finding new ways to bypass filters and reach consumers.
To counter this, communication service providers (CSPs) are implementing advanced analytics and machine learning algorithms to identify patterns indicative of spam activity. These technologies can detect unusual calling behavior, such as high call volumes from unknown numbers or rapid number porting, enabling CSPs to block or flag these calls more effectively.
